Klaus Barbie was born Nikolaus Barbie in 1913 near Bonn, a frustrated theology student whose plans collapsed after his brother and father died in 1933. He joined the SS and its intelligence arm, the SD, and served in Amsterdam before being assigned to Lyon in 1942, where he ran the local Gestapo from the Hotel Terminus and earned the nickname the Butcher of Lyon.

Unlike the desk-bound bureaucrats of the era, Barbie personally engaged in torture and was responsible for the deportation of up to 14,000 Jews and resistance fighters. Recruited by U.S. intelligence after the war and later shielded by West German intelligence, he fled to Bolivia via the rat lines, advised dictators, and was finally exposed by journalists, extradited, and tried in Lyon in 1987.
